2027: Wike Picks George-Kelly, Chinda as APC, PDP guber aspirants

16
0

Fresh political intrigue is unfolding in Rivers State as Nyesom Wike is reportedly backing two loyal allies to contest the 2027 governorship election on separate political platforms, a move that signals a calculated strategy to maintain influence regardless of party outcomes.

According to emerging reports, Alabo Dakorinama George-Kelly has been tipped to run under the All Progressives Congress, while Kingsley Chinda, the Minority Leader of the House of Representatives, is being positioned to contest on the platform of the Peoples Democratic Party. Both individuals are said to be key members of the Rainbow Coalition, a political bloc closely aligned with Wike.  

Sources familiar with the development revealed that the coalition leadership encouraged the duo to purchase nomination forms within their respective parties, effectively placing strong contenders in both APC and PDP camps ahead of the primaries. The reported endorsement of George-Kelly, in particular, has generated excitement among some stakeholders in Rivers State. His entry into the race is said to have been met with jubilation, especially among youth groups and political actors who believe his candidacy resonates strongly across different segments of the state. Analysts note that his background and perceived loyalty to Wike may have contributed to his growing acceptance.  

George-Kelly, a former governorship aspirant who came second in the 2022 PDP primary, is regarded as a long time political associate of Wike. His emergence aligns with sentiments in some quarters advocating for power rotation to the riverine Ijaw axis, adding another layer of political calculation to the unfolding scenario.  

On the other hand, the inclusion of Kingsley Chinda in the PDP race has sparked mixed reactions. While he remains a prominent political figure, some stakeholders reportedly expressed reservations about his candidacy, suggesting that his name did not generate the same level of enthusiasm across the state.  

Despite the growing speculation, there has been no official confirmation from Wike or the coalition regarding the final decision. However, insiders suggest that the minister is carefully assessing public sentiment and political dynamics before making a definitive move, reinforcing his reputation as a calculated and strategic political operator.  

Observers believe the development reflects a broader trend in Nigerian politics where influence is often maintained through strategic placements across multiple platforms. By positioning allies in both major parties, Wike appears to be hedging his political bets while ensuring that his influence remains deeply embedded in the state’s power structure.

As the 2027 elections draw closer, the situation in Rivers State is expected to evolve further, with party primaries, alliances, and possible counter moves shaping what is already emerging as a high stakes political contest. For now, the reported positioning of George-Kelly and Chinda highlights the intensity of behind the scenes maneuvering and the growing significance of strategic alliances in Nigeria’s political landscape.
